Transaction 52468f41e06ebaef57d995b3f61f135e1633949b754d8b49f09a3c26fc84dba1
1 Input
1 Output
-
52468f41e06ebaef57d995b3f61f135e1633949b754d8b49f09a3c26fc84dba1:0
- value
- 62562825
- script pubkey
- OP_0 OP_PUSHBYTES_20 321f7c6faf0df3c7992d0303c05c7ae10037c0f3
- address
- bc1qxg0hcma0pheu0xfdqvpuqhr6uyqr0s8n4ta2k0